UVA School of Education and Human Development Awards $1.2 Million in Student Scholarships

More than 250 students received grant funding from the school in 2024 to support their studies.

Each year UVA's School of Education and Human Development grants awards, scholarships, and fellowships to support the studies of UVA EHD students. In 2024, awards given to more than 250 individual students totaled more than $1.2 million.

EHD honored those students and celebrated their accomplishments in a ceremony held on Grounds on Friday, October 4.

“At UVA EHD, we are committed to making education more accessible by reducing financial barriers for our students,” said Dean Stephanie Rowley. “These students have demonstrated extraordinary potential to lead and innovate in education and human development, and we are proud to support them with awards that help them reach their academic and professional goals.”

Unlike student loans, grant funding does not have to be repaid, helping alleviate the financial burden of higher education and allowing students to fully immerse themselves in their studies. Award and scholarship recipients are nominated by program faculty and selected by departments and programs.

This year, UVA EHD also launched the Tomorrow’s Teachers Fund, which provides crucial tuition assistance of up to $30,000 for students with demonstrated financial need. Additional funding and financial support are available to all UVA students through UVA Student Financial Services.

Samuel Diemer, a master’s student who plans to become a social studies teacher, said he was deeply honored and grateful to be a recipient of the Odelia Moore scholarship. “I chose to become a teacher because I have always had a passion for learning and a desire to inspire that same passion in others,” he said. “This award is more than just financial support; it is a powerful affirmation of confidence in my potential and future.”
